The Order to Cash (OTC) Accountant will play a crucial role in ensuring timely and accurate completion of financial and accounting processes within the Shared Service Center (SSC). The role involves supporting the OTC Manager and ensuring high-quality services for the entities serviced by the SSC. Order to Cash Operations:

\n\n
    \n\t
  • \n\t

    Execute end-to-end OtC processes, including payment processing, bank statement posting, allocations, and cash planning.

    \n\t
  • \n\t
  • \n\t

    Ensure accurate financial postings in compliance with global accounting standards and SSC policies.

    \n\t
  • \n\t
  • \n\t

    Monitor and maintain key balance sheet accounts (cash, bank, AR, and fleet-related accounts).

    \n\t
  • \n\t
  • \n\t

    Allocate incoming and outgoing payments within agreed SLAs; follow up on unallocated or unclear payments.

    \n\t
  • \n\t
  • \n\t

    Maintain and optimize Auto Bank/automated clearing settings to improve straight-through processing.

    \n\t
  • \n
\n\n

Payment & Bank Management:

\n\n
    \n\t
  • \n\t

    Prepare, validate, and review payment run files for accuracy and compliance.

    \n\t
  • \n\t
  • \n\t

    Ensure timely payment approvals in line with the Group Finance Manual.

    \n\t
  • \n\t
  • \n\t

    Update customer and vendor bank account details accurately and promptly.

    \n\t
  • \n\t
  • \n\t

    Perform monthly bank reconciliations and ensure accurate reflection of bank balances.

    \n\t
  • \n\t
  • \n\t

    Maintain updated bank accounts, user access, signatories, and approvers according to governance requirements.

    \n\t
  • \n\t
  • \n\t

    Coordinate training and onboarding for new system users on bank-related processes.

    \n\t
  • \n
\n\n

Cash & Liquidity Management:

\n\n
    \n\t
  • \n\t

    Use Group Liquidity Planning tools to assess and manage cash positions.

    \n\t
  • \n\t
  • \n\t

    Collaborate with Financial Business Partners (FBPs) and Group Treasury to execute short-term and long-term liquidity plans.

    \n\t
  • \n\t
  • \n\t

    Provide transparency on cash forecast accuracy and propose funding solutions when required.
